Web6 mei 2016 · Nursing Diagnosis: § Tissue Perfusion, risk for ineffective: peripheral Risk factors: § Reduced arterial/venous blood flow; tissue edema, hematoma formation § Hypovolemia Desired Outcomes: § Patient will Maintain adequate tissue perfusion as evidenced by palpable peripheral pulses, warm/dry skin, and timely wound healing. Web25 jul. 2008 · The goal of establishing discomfort as a nursing diagnosis is to facilitate clinicians' ability to identify an anecdotally common phenomenon that requires nursing interventions and outcome evaluation. The preliminary data on this diagnostic concept is insufficient to demonstrate defining characteristics or related factors.
